MySQL数据修改日志(通常指的是二进制日志,Binary Log)是MySQL数据库记录所有数据修改操作(如INSERT、UPDATE、DELETE)的一种日志文件。它记录了数据库的所有更改,以便在数据丢失或损坏时进行恢复,同时也是实现主从复制的关键组件。
SHOW VARIABLES LIKE 'log_bin';
SHOW BINARY LOGS;
SHOW BINLOG EVENTS IN 'mysql-bin.000001';
原因:MySQL服务器未配置启用二进制日志。
解决方法:
编辑MySQL配置文件(通常是my.cnf
或my.ini
),添加或修改以下配置:
[mysqld]
log-bin=mysql-bin
然后重启MySQL服务器:
sudo systemctl restart mysql
原因:可能是权限不足或二进制日志文件损坏。
解决方法:
SUPER
权限。SUPER
权限。mysqlbinlog
工具进行修复:mysqlbinlog
工具进行修复:希望这些信息对你有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云